Carhartt Rugged Flex Utility Work Pants

These pants are a great option for those who want a relaxed fit and a durable pair of pants. They are made with a 12 oz, 99% cotton, 1% spandex duck fabric that is both comfortable and durable. 

The pants also feature deep front pockets, left and right phone pockets, a right utility pocket, a right hammer loop, and reinforced back pockets. This makes them perfect for carpenters and handymen who need a lot of storage space for their tools and supplies.

Dickies Relaxed Heavyweight Duck Carpenter Pants

These pants are another great option for those who want a relaxed fit and a durable pair of pants. They are made with a 12 oz, 100% cotton duck fabric that is both comfortable and durable. 

The pants also feature a relaxed fit through the thigh and knee, with a tapered leg that is designed to fit comfortably over work boots. The pants also have a lot of storage space, with deep front pockets and a right utility pocket.

WHAT TO LOOK FOR IN THE BEST CARPENTER PANTS

When searching for the best carpenter pants, several key features must be considered. These pants are designed to provide comfort, durability, and functionality for individuals who work in various industries, such as construction, woodworking, or roofing. Here are the essential elements to look for in the best carpenter pants:

  • Deep front and back pockets: Carpenter pants typically have deep pockets to store essential tools, such as a hammer, tape measure, or level. These pockets should be roomy enough to hold the items you need without compromising the overall fit of the pants.
  • Hammer loop: A hammer loop is a convenient feature that allows you to store your hammer within easy reach easily. This loop should be sturdy and securely attached to the pants to prevent it from coming loose during use.
  • Utility pocket: A utility pocket on the side of the pants leg is useful for storing small items like a phone, wallet, or notebook. This pocket should have a secure closure to prevent items from falling out.
  • Reinforced knees: Reinforced knees are a must-have feature in carpenter pants. They provide extra durability and protection against wear and tear, ensuring the pants remain functional for longer.
  • Rivet details: Rivet details add a touch of style to the pants while also providing additional reinforcement. These rivets should be securely attached to the fabric to prevent them from coming loose over time.
  • Material: Carpenter pants are typically made from durable materials like cotton, polyester, or both. Look for pants with a thick, heavy-duty fabric that can withstand the rigours of daily use.
  • Comfort: Carpenter pants should be designed for comfort, with features like adjustable waistbands, articulated knees, and breathable fabrics to keep you cool and dry during long work hours.
  • Style: While functionality is crucial, carpenter pants can also be stylish. Look for pants with a modern design, bold colours, or unique details that reflect your personal style.
  • Brand reputation: Consider the reputation of the brand you are purchasing from. Look for brands that specialize in workwear and have a history of producing high-quality, durable products.

FAQs

What are carpenter pants? 

Carpenter pants are sturdy trousers made for work but are now also worn for style. They have extra pockets and loops for tools like hammers.

Why are they popular in fashion now? 

They are in style because they are practical and look different from regular pants. Designers are including them in trendy outfits.

What should I look for in carpenter pants? 

Look for strong materials like cotton or denim. They should have a comfortable fit and lots of pockets for your things.
